c++ - Visual Studio 2010 非常慢,无法使用

标签 c++ c visual-studio-2010 performance

我已经搜索过这个主题,但似乎找不到与我的经历完全相关的帖子。

我有一个需要处理的 Visual Studio 解决方案,它相当大,包含 16 个项目。

一切都是那么缓慢和波涛汹涌(除了启动,它实际上非常快)。

在文本编辑器中单击一行,移动光标大约需要 5 秒。

在文件之间切换 ~1-2 个地雷(如果我幸运的话)

点击“工具”~ 2 分钟后下拉菜单出现。

如果我右键单击其中一个项目,那么它会在我获得下拉菜单之前大约 5-10 分钟。在此期间,我的整个 PC 都锁定了。

关闭 Visual Studio(愤怒)~10-20 分钟

至于调试和构建.. 好吧,我从来没有走到那一步。

查看任务管理器(使用 Visual Studio 打开它需要很长时间)没有任何运行消耗大量内存/cpu。

我知道 Microsoft 产品并不以速度快而闻名,但这很荒谬,我无法编写这样的代码。一定有问题。

任何帮助将不胜感激,我的脑袋都准备好了。

Visual Studio 2010 Ultimate SP1

Windows 7 x64

英特尔 i7 950 @ 3.07GHz

6GB RAM(三 channel )

2x nVidia GTX 470 (SLI)

最佳答案

我的鼠标也滞后于菜单!对于灰显的菜单,这很好。但是对于事件菜单,鼠标在它们上方移动时会感觉很粘。

我尝试过的一个解决方案是禁用丰富的用户体验并禁用硬件加速。

工具 -> 选项 -> 环境(常规) -> 视觉体验 -> 取消选中使用硬件图形加速器(如果可用)。

我的显卡很好,但是停止使用图形硬件让 Visual Studio 现在让我的鼠标非常流畅!

关于c++ - Visual Studio 2010 非常慢,无法使用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5463408/

相关文章:

c++ - 使用 QueryPerformanceCounter() 倒计时

C++ Primer 计数错误

c - 如何快速转储信息?

c - 以二进制模式写入文件时, '\n' 是如何编码的?

c++ - 您最喜欢用 C/C++ 访问多个不同数据库(MySQL、Oracle...)的跨平台解决方案是什么?

c++ - 使用具有相对路径的 CreateProcess

使用多个线程计算给定间隔的总和

wpf - 从 g.cs 文件中删除旧的命名空间?

visual-studio-2010 - 如何在 SSL 环境中调试服务器端代码?

visual-studio-2010 - 使用 Azure 计算模拟器调试角色实例的问题, '/' 应用程序中的服务器错误